Detailed information for compound 1252723

Basic information

Technical information
  • TDR Targets ID: 1252723
  • Name: 2-methyl-6-[[4-[(3-methylphenyl)amino]-6-(pro pan-2-ylamino)-1,3,5-triazin-2-yl]oxy]pyridaz in-3-one
  • MW: 367.405 | Formula: C18H21N7O2
  • H donors: 2 H acceptors: 4 LogP: 3.16 Rotable bonds: 6
    Rule of 5 violations (Lipinski): 1
  • SMILES: CC(Nc1nc(nc(n1)Nc1cccc(c1)C)Oc1ccc(=O)n(n1)C)C
  • InChi: 1S/C18H21N7O2/c1-11(2)19-16-21-17(20-13-7-5-6-12(3)10-13)23-18(22-16)27-14-8-9-15(26)25(4)24-14/h5-11H,1-4H3,(H2,19,20,21,22,23)
  • InChiKey: QWUGEPXYICAZFI-UHFFFAOYSA-N

Activities

Activity type Activity value Assay description Source Reference
Potency (functional) 1.0323 uM PUBCHEM_BIOASSAY: Nrf2 qHTS screen for inhibitors.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ID493153, AID493163, AID504648] ChEMBL. No reference
Potency (functional) = 3.9811 um PUBCHEM_BIOASSAY: qHTS Assay for Agonists of the Thyroid Stimulating Hormone Receptor. (Class of assay: confirmatory) ChEMBL. No reference
Potency (functional) 23.1093 uM PUBCHEM_BIOASSAY: qHTS screen for small molecules that inhibit ELG1-dependent DNA repair in human embryonic kidney (HEK293T) cells expressing luciferase-tagged ELG1.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ID493107, AID493125] ChEMBL. No reference
